Ford Transit 2.4 Injection System Diagnostics & Solutions

The Ford Transit's 2.4 liter motor is renowned for its reliability, but even the best systems can encounter issues. When your Transit's 2.4 injection system begins to malfunction, it can manifest in a range of symptoms, from rough idling and reduced power to increased fuel consumption and even engine misfires. Identifying the source of the problem is crucial for effective repairs.

A comprehensive diagnostic process requires specialized tools and expertise. Starting with a visual inspection, technicians will look for any obvious signs of damage or leaks in the fuel lines, injectors, and other components. Subsequently, they'll utilize scan tools to read the vehicle's diagnostic trouble codes (DTCs), which can pinpoint specific areas of concern within the injection system.

  • Frequent issues encountered in the 2.4 liter injection system include faulty fuel injectors, malfunctioning fuel pressure sensors, and failures of the high-pressure fuel pump.
  • Repair solutions can range from simple component replacements to more complex repairs involving recalibrations or software updates. It's essential to consult a qualified mechanic who has experience working on Ford Transit vehicles and their injection systems.

The Ford Transit Injection Module: Functionality

The Motorcraft Transit injection module is a vital component in the vehicle's powertrain system. It's responsible for controlling and regulating the amount of fuel injected into the engine, ensuring efficient combustion. The module processes input from various sensors throughout the vehicle, such as the oxygen sensor, to calculate the precise amount of air mixture required for smooth engine operation.

  • Generally found mounted near the fuel rail, the injection module is a highly integrated circuit. It utilizes precise calculations to control combustion.
  • Malfunctions in the injection module can result in a range of symptoms, including poor fuel economy. Identifying these malfunctions often requires advanced equipment.

Proper care of the injection module, including inspecting wiring harnesses, can help extend its lifespan. Knowing how this critical component operates is essential for ensuring optimal engine health.
